Understanding 15-5 PH: What Makes This Alloy Different

15-5 PH (UNS S15500) is a precipitation hardening martensitic chromium-nickel-copper stainless steel that has become a cornerstone material for high-strength applications in aerospace, oil and gas, and precision manufacturing industries. Unlike conventional stainless steels that rely solely on chromium for corrosion resistance, 15-5 PH achieves its exceptional mechanical properties through a specialized heat treatment process called precipitation hardening.

This alloy occupies a unique position in the stainless steel family—offering better toughness than the more common 17-4 PH while maintaining comparable corrosion resistance to 304 stainless steel. The key differentiator lies in its chemical composition and the flexibility it provides through multiple heat treatment conditions.

15-5 PH Chemical Composition vs. Common Alternatives

Element15-5 PH17-4 PH304 Stainless
Chromium (Cr)14.5-15.5%15.0-17.5%18.0-20.0%
Nickel (Ni)3.5-5.5%3.0-5.0%8.0-10.5%
Copper (Cu)2.5-4.5%3.0-5.0%0%
Carbon (C)≤0.07%≤0.07%≤0.08%
Key CharacteristicSuperior transverse toughnessMost widely used PH gradeGeneral purpose corrosion resistance
Data compiled from ATI Materials Technical Data Sheet and AZoM Materials Database [2][3]
Mechanical Performance: 15-5 PH in H900 condition achieves tensile strength of 190 ksi (1310 MPa) and yield strength of 170 ksi (1170 MPa), making it one of the strongest stainless steels available for commercial applications [3].

Heat Treatment Conditions: The Six Paths to Performance

One of the most important decisions when specifying 15-5 PH is selecting the appropriate heat treatment condition. This alloy can be supplied in six different conditions, designated H900 through H1150, each offering a different balance of strength, toughness, and corrosion resistance. 15-5 PH Heat Treatment Conditions and Properties

ConditionTreatment TemperatureTensile Strength (ksi)Yield Strength (ksi)Best For
H900900°F (482°C)190170Maximum strength applications
H925925°F (496°C)180165High strength with improved toughness
H10251025°F (552°C)155145Balanced strength and corrosion resistance
H10751075°F (579°C)145130Enhanced corrosion resistance
H11001100°F (593°C)140125Good toughness and corrosion resistance
H11501150°F (621°C)135120Maximum corrosion resistance and toughness
Source: ATI Materials 15-5 PH Technical Data Sheet [3]. Strength values are approximate and may vary by product form and manufacturer.

The H900 condition delivers the highest strength but sacrifices some corrosion resistance and toughness. Conversely, H1150 provides the best corrosion resistance—comparable to 304 stainless steel—but at lower strength levels. Key application sectors driving 15-5 PH demand include:

Aerospace: Landing gear components, engine parts, structural fittings, and fasteners where high strength-to-weight ratio is critical. The alloy's superior transverse toughness makes it particularly suitable for components subjected to multi-directional stress [1][3].

Oil & Gas: Valves, pump shafts, and downhole equipment operating in corrosive environments. The H1150 condition is often specified for maximum corrosion resistance in sour gas applications [1].

Industrial Manufacturing: Gears, bearings, molds, and high-stress mechanical components. The ability to machine in solution-treated condition and then age-harden to final properties simplifies manufacturing workflows [2].

Medical Devices: Surgical instruments and implantable device components requiring biocompatibility, strength, and corrosion resistance [1].

15-5 PH vs. Alternatives: Making the Right Choice

While 15-5 PH offers excellent properties, it's not always the optimal choice. Understanding when to recommend 15-5 PH versus alternatives like 17-4 PH, 17-7 PH, or conventional austenitic stainless steels is essential for manufacturers advising buyers on Alibaba.com.

Configuration Comparison: 15-5 PH vs. Common Alternatives

Factor15-5 PH17-4 PH17-7 PH304 Stainless
Relative CostHigherModerate (most common)HigherLowest
Maximum StrengthVery High (190 ksi)Very High (190 ksi)High (170 ksi)Moderate (75 ksi)
ToughnessSuperior transverseGood longitudinalExcellentGood
Corrosion ResistanceGood (H1150 ≈ 304)ModerateGoodExcellent
Heat Treat Options6 conditions (H900-H1150)4 conditions (H900-H1150)Complex (multiple processes)None (annealed only)
Best ApplicationsAerospace structural, high-stressGeneral PH applicationsSprings, high-tempGeneral corrosion resistance
MachinabilityGood (in solution treated)Good (in solution treated)FairExcellent
AvailabilityModerateExcellentLimitedExcellent
Comparison based on industry technical data and market availability. Actual performance varies by manufacturer and specific product form [2][3].

When 15-5 PH is the Right Choice:

  • Components subjected to multi-directional stress where transverse toughness is critical (e.g., landing gear fittings, structural aerospace components)

  • Applications requiring customizable strength-corrosion balance through heat treatment selection

  • Environments where corrosion resistance comparable to 304 is needed alongside high strength (H1150 condition)

When to Consider Alternatives:

  • 17-4 PH: For cost-sensitive applications where transverse toughness is less critical. 17-4 PH is more widely available and often more economical [2].

  • 17-7 PH: For applications requiring excellent fatigue resistance and higher temperature performance (springs, high-temperature components) [6].

  • 304 Stainless: For general corrosion resistance applications where high strength is not required. Significantly lower cost and easier to source [4].

Q: What heat treatment condition do you recommend for aerospace landing gear components?

A: H900 or H925 conditions are typically specified for landing gear due to maximum strength requirements. However, final selection should be based on the specific component's stress profile and corrosion environment. Always request the buyer's engineering specifications before quoting [3].

Q: Can you provide material certification?

A: Yes, reputable suppliers should provide mill test reports (MTRs) with chemistry analysis and mechanical property test results. For aerospace applications, certifications to AMS 5659 or AMS 5862 may be required [3].

Q: How does 15-5 PH compare to 17-4 PH for my application?

A: 15-5 PH offers superior transverse toughness, making it better for components with multi-directional stress. 17-4 PH is more economical and widely available for applications where longitudinal properties dominate. Review the buyer's specific requirements before recommending [2].
